On Fri, Feb 07, 2025 at 12:59:01PM +0530, Satyanarayana K V P wrote:
> As per the current implementation, the fault is injected on the first call
> of the error injection function. Introduce an environment variable
> IGT_FAULT_INJECT_ITERATION using which, an error can be injected at
> specific function call. If the environment is not exported, an error will
> be injected in every possible function call starting from first up to the
> max number of iteration defined by INJECT_ITERATIONS, currently hardcoded
> as 100.
This description does not fit the patch, which adds one function that is
not used yet. If I understand correctly it is exclusively intended for
use in probe_fail_guc(), so it might be best to merge this patch and the
next one in the series.

> +static int get_fault_inject_iter(void)
> +{
> + /**
> + * Introduce a new env variable IGT_FAULT_INJECT_ITERATION.
> + * When unset test will run for INJECT_ITERATIONS iterations.
> + * When set to <=0 or malformed - same as unset.
> + * When set to >0 it will run single n-th iteration only.
> + */
> +
> + const char *env = getenv("IGT_FAULT_INJECT_ITERATION");
> +
> + /* Return 0 if not exported / -ve value */
> + return env ? (atoi(env) > 0 ? atoi(env) : 0) : 0;
> +}
